Pork tenderloin is the most tender cut of Bísaro pork, taken from the inner part of the loin. With a delicate texture and mild flavour, it is a meat that practically melts in the mouth when well cooked.
Coming from pigs raised freely in the countryside and fed chestnuts, Bísaro pork tenderloin has the fine intramuscular fat that characterises the breed, guaranteeing marbled, tender and succulent meat.
